Solution for -21+3r=8(1+4r) equation:


Simplifying
-21 + 3r = 8(1 + 4r)
-21 + 3r = (1 * 8 + 4r * 8)
-21 + 3r = (8 + 32r)

Solving
-21 + 3r = 8 + 32r

Solving for variable 'r'.

Move all terms containing r to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-32r' to each side of the equation.
-21 + 3r + -32r = 8 + 32r + -32r

Combine like terms: 3r + -32r = -29r
-21 + -29r = 8 + 32r + -32r

Combine like terms: 32r + -32r = 0
-21 + -29r = 8 + 0
-21 + -29r = 8

Add '21' to each side of the equation.
-21 + 21 + -29r = 8 + 21

Combine like terms: -21 + 21 = 0
0 + -29r = 8 + 21
-29r = 8 + 21

Combine like terms: 8 + 21 = 29
-29r = 29

Divide each side by '-29'.
r = -1

Simplifying
r = -1
